Home & Contents Insurance Building Only Insurance Contents Only Insurance Landlord Insurance Comprehensive Car Insurance Third Party Car Insurance Motorcycle Insurance CTP Insurance Caravan Insurance Travel Insurance Health Insurance Life Insurance Income Protection Funeral Insurance When your home is substantially damaged by an insured event (meaning the cost for us to repair is at least $50,000 or 10% of your home sum insured, whichever is more). Please Refer to PDS for Full Details. Cyclone and storm Swap existing materials for more resilient materials (eg tiles instead of carpet) Install cyclone washers and roof sarking Install cyclone shutters / metal roller blinds / garage door bracing Flood Swap existing materials for more resilient materials (eg tiles instead of carpet) Raise external services around the home (eg air conditioning units, hot water systems, pool pump) Bushfire Install metal gutters and metal gutter guards with apertures less than 1.8mm Install draught stoppers for windows and doors Install roof sprinklers Working claims Replace and install all flexi hoses in the home Install solid core doors or upgrade deadlocks The above are examples only. Resiliency building enhancements will be discussed with eligible customers who meet the claim requirements and will depend on the level of cover they hold.

Classify each sentence as substantive or hollow. Grounding markers — numbers, currencies, dates, technical units, named entities — outweigh marketing adjectives. When fluff sits right next to hard evidence, the fluff is forgiven.
Pull the main entities out of the H1, then check whether they actually recur through the body. A page that announces one thing and then talks about another drifts. Headings with no real sentences underneath read as pseudo-substance.
Count trust words (review, testimonial, rating, verified) against real outbound proof links (Google, Trustpilot, Clutch, G2, Yelp). Lots of trust language with zero verification links is trust theatre. Unlinked logo galleries count against it.
Look at how much sentence length varies. Natural writing varies its rhythm; templated or mass-produced copy is statistically uniform. Very low variation reads as commodity content — unless unique named entities break the pattern.
Inspect the JSON-LD. Is there an Organization or Person schema, and does it carry sameAs links to real external profiles (LinkedIn, socials)? Missing schema or no identity declaration signals an anonymous entity.
